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4781457916 5479500 6002561
26 66588973
26 66588973
93 69293729 60962 02
All about undefined
Interested in learning more?
26 66588973
93 69293729 60962 02
See more
5419662 05 5072
204 68260 95013201 27043249339 8816
See more
187210 64187156 4814000646
513 634176 830
See more